Abstract
Abstract Dialectical Frameworks (ADF) are a well known and understood generalisation of Dung's Argumentation frameworks. Multiple approaches to solve the computation and enumeration of the semantics have been proposed over the last decade. One recent approach is to solve the computational hard problems by translating the acceptance condition of a given ADF into reduced ordered binary decision diagrams (roBDD). The use of roBDDs lays a foundation for straightforward graphical visualization of the underlying ADFs and their solutions. In this work, we present ADF-BDD.DEV, a web-service that generates graphical representations of ADFs and for different semantics, allowing their comparison and to spot the influence of yet undecided statements. We propose that this is a first steps towards better explainability and understanding of ADFs.
